The National Council of European Integration meeting, Minister Xhaçka: The European Commission’s positive report is an impetus to make our membership in the EU a reality as soon as possible

The Minister for Europe and Foreign Affairs, Olta Xhaçka, spoke about the European Commission report on Albania at the meeting of the National Council for European Integration.
Minister Xhaçka emphasized that the report recognizes the great work that has been done and confirms Albania’s progress in its journey towards European integration.
“What stands out in this report is the evaluation of Albania’s role as an active and reliable partner of the EU, with a foreign policy that is based on European values and fully aligned with the EU’s restrictive statements and decisions within the common foreign and security policy. We see the way forward, we know our tasks. It will be a difficult road, but we must be together in this process. Our common obligation is to make our EU membership a reality as soon as possible”, she said.
The European Commission’s report on Albania 2022, which was published on October 13, is a working document that, after identifying achievements, defines the areas where joint work and dialogue with the European Commission will be focused in the coming weeks and months.
